1. There are no results for Kilof Ruthe

    • Check your spelling or try different keywords

    Ref A: 67a6af31db7b4129b825f5b1cdf21ad4 Ref B: MWHEEEAP005CFA3 Ref C: 2025-02-08T01:11:13Z